Teachers form the backbone of educational institutions, delivering instruction across subjects and grade levels while shaping students' academic and personal development. Whether working in elementary, middle, or high schools, teachers design curriculum, facilitate learning experiences, assess student progress, and maintain classroom environments that support growth and engagement.

The role extends well beyond delivering lessons. Teachers develop lesson plans aligned with educational standards, create or adapt instructional materials, evaluate student work, communicate with families about progress, and often serve as mentors to students navigating academic and social challenges. Many teachers also participate in professional development, collaborate with colleagues on curriculum initiatives, and take on additional responsibilities like sponsoring clubs or supervising extracurricular activities.

Why Teaching Matters in Schools

Schools depend on skilled teachers to implement their mission and meet diverse student needs. Teachers work with students across varying ability levels, learning styles, and backgrounds, requiring adaptability and cultural competence. They're responsible for monitoring student progress, identifying learning gaps, and adjusting instruction accordingly. In doing so, teachers contribute directly to student outcomes—both academically and developmentally—making their impact measurable and meaningful over time.

Teaching also requires classroom management skills, patience, and the ability to build positive relationships with students and families. Effective teachers create inclusive environments where all students feel supported and motivated to learn, which influences both immediate academic performance and long-term student success.

Career Path and Development

Most teaching positions require at least a bachelor's degree and state certification or licensing, though requirements vary by location and subject area. Early in a teaching career, educators often work as classroom teachers, building experience and developing their instructional practice. As teachers advance, many pursue leadership roles such as department head, instructional coach, or curriculum coordinator positions, which allow them to influence school-wide practices and mentor other educators.

Other teachers specialize in specific areas, such as special education, English language learner support, or gifted education. Some move into administrative roles like assistant principal or principal, while others transition into education technology, instructional design, or educational consulting. Professional development opportunities—including advanced certifications, master's degrees, and workshops—help teachers deepen subject matter expertise and stay current with pedagogical approaches.

Teaching careers offer variety in terms of subject matter, grade levels, and school settings. Teachers work in public and private schools, charter schools, and alternative educational environments. The profession rewards those who remain committed to continuous improvement, student-centered teaching, and collaboration with colleagues.
